The online racing simulator
Searching in All forums
(1 results)
joemaddog
Demo licensed
well i am new to lfs, i was looking around for a new game to play, i vote yes to steam, i would of know about this game long ago, i played race07 on steam for years on without any problems and trackmania.
FGED GREDG RDFGDR GSFDG